Title :
A mm-wave monolithic Gilbert-cell mixer

Abstract :
This paper describes the application of the well-known Gilbert-cell mixer technique at mm-wave frequencies. A pseudomorphic HEMT monolithic design is described, in conjunction with a bondwire compensation technique, to produce low conversion loss (<4 dB) with low LO power at frequencies beyond 40 GHz.
